Chinese ambassador to Israel found dead at home, says Israeli foreign ministry By Stephen Sorace Fox News May 17, 2020 China’s ambassador to Israel was found dead inside his home north of Tel Aviv on Sunday, the Israeli Foreign Ministry said. Du Wei, 57, arrived in Israel in mid-February amid the coronavirus outbreak and was living in the coastal city of Herzliya on the outskirts of Tel Aviv. He previously served as China’s envoy to Ukraine. Staff found Du unresponsive in his bed with no signs of violence to his body, the Haaretz daily reported. Initial media reports…

Burr’s alleged conflicts extend beyond his coronavirus-related stock trades By Maggie Severns POLITICO May 16, 2020 The insider trading investigation stemming from Sen. Richard Burr’s sale of stocks ahead of the coronavirus pandemic highlights the North Carolina Republican’s long record of investing in companies with business before his committees, according to a POLITICO review of eight years of his trades. While Burr sat on committees focused on health care, taxes and trade, he and his wife bought and sold hundreds of thousands of dollars of stock in an array of health care companies, banks and corporations with business…

Washington Post May 14, 2020 The Wisconsin Supreme Court’s conservative majority sided with Republican legislators and struck down on Wednesday the decision by Democratic Gov. Tony Evers’s administration to extend a stay-at-home order intended to quell the spread of the novel coronavirus. The 4-3 decision limits Evers’s ability to make statewide rules during emergencies such as a global pandemic, instead requiring him to work with the state legislature on how the state should handle the outbreak. The justices wrote that the court was not challenging the governor’s power to declare emergencies, “but in the case of a pandemic, which…
